LAPD Officer Ranks Shrink Below 9,000

The Department grew to more than 9,000 in the ‘90s when Mayor Richard Riordan and the City Council were united in efforts to try to grow the department to at least 10,000 officers.

Former Minneapolis Officer Sentenced to 57 Months Over George Floyd Death

Tou Thao was sentenced Monday morning to 57 months in prison for his role in the killing of George Floyd, becoming the fourth and final ex-officer to be sentenced in the state’s Floyd cases.
